Simulations of two qubit gate dynamics have illustrated the well known trade-off between coherent and incoherent errors as a function of gate speed. Faster gates are less susceptible to the incoherent error caused by qubit relaxation, while slower gates have lower levels of coherent error due to unwanted interactions with the non-computational states of the transmon. Recent improvements in our junction fabrication processes and cryo-packaging have led to the realization of fixed frequency qubits with lifetimes and coherence times in excess of 100 us. This suggests that we may be able to reach error rates as low as 0.1% with an optimal choice of gate time.
